Project Abstract
The increasing global focus on sustainable practices and energy efficiency has led to a growing interest in the development and implementation of smart buildings. These intelligent structures leverage advanced technologies to monitor and control various systems, with the aim of optimizing energy consumption and reducing environmental impact. The research project titled "Analysis and Optimization of Energy Consumption in Smart Buildings" seeks to explore the potential benefits and challenges associated with this emerging field.
